    float test turns to shakedown

    Hey guys, I must say thank you to all who have participated in this build, provided input and encouragement as well as all who have followed.

    I took her out this afternoon to do a "float test" and since she passed the test, I decided it was time for the shakedown test. I wouldn't call this the maiden voyage yet cause she didn't really go very far. She did prove her prowess and I am amazed at the success of this shakedown.

    I tooled around for maybe a minute or so and after I brought her in and opened her up, motors were 85 F, ESCs 115F, batts 110 F. I ran on 4S1P each motor with 4800 mah and 25C. I used up maybe 15% of the juice. Egnegs X442s props, Jeff's drives and couplers, Peter's mounts, and the near donation of the hull from Camel have really come together into a fine piece of art - that will haul balls and keep them on the wall!!!

                          Glad to hear it Tom, patience and attention to detail really do pay off in the end. My two brothers (7 & 8 yrs older) rush everything and it shows too.

                          Nate, I have run one of these motors in my 26" mono on 6S with a K42 and after several minutes of terrorizing the pond at 50 mph, temps were all very nice and battery consumption was at about 25%. This is the reason I chose this set up.

                          442 prop selection has nothing to do with the fact that Octura right hand props are made in a wide variety of sizes.... that is 430, 442 and 447 ...... If anybody knows of any other brands that make other sizes please let me know.

                          That said, I will be starting out with 4S, then 5S and if all goes well........ 6S
